JOHNSON SCORES BIG WIN IN ADVANCE AUTO PARTS SUPER DIRT 100



MYERS WINS ON LAST LAP IN LATE MODELS

Alan Johnson of Phelps, NY started seventh and took the lead from Steve Paine on the 24th lap and never looked back as he picked up the win in the 100-lap Advance Auto Parts DIRT modified feature. Once Johnson got to the front, he pulled away from the field and lapped all but eight cars in a dominating performance that earned him $6,000. Thursday night special event was postponed from March 26th.

"The car just couldn't have been any better, I just have to thank Robbie and the crew." said Johnson. "They just had the car perfect for me and all I had to do was drive it. The car worked up high, worked down low, it is a fun place to race."

Allen Brannon led the first 24 laps and looked like he would capture his second win of the season. But it was D.J. Myers of Greencastle, PA in front when it counted as he passed race long leader Brannon coming off the fourth turn on the final lap to win the 25-lap late model feature by a nose.

"We worked for that one," said Myers after collecting his first win of the year. "I went down into the corner and kept saying to myself use your hear, use your head. I just went in the turn straight, knew there was traction down low and knew Nathan (Durboraw) and Allen (Brannon) were over running themselves. I just went in there and got a good run on them. I can't say I knew I had them, but once Nathan moved to the top that's what I needed and it gave me the advantage on the bottom. And when we came off the fourth turn, I knew Allen would be high so I just came off as hard as I could."

Steve Paine grabbed the lead from the pole with Jamie Mills in pursuit. Jimmy Phelps and Frank Cozze moved into third and fourth as Johnson worked his way into the top five by the 11th lap. On lap 16, Phelps grabbed second from Mills as Johnson moved into third four laps later. Johnson took over second on lap 22 and two laps later on lap 24 grabbed the lead from Paine. The second and only caution of the race was waved on lap 53 putting the rest of the field on Johnson's bumper. But once the race resumed, Johnson pulled away and by the 65th lap was putting the slower cars a lap down. Pat Ward was able to close in on Johnson a couple of times in lapped traffic, but was never a serious contender as Johnson dominated the last 30 laps. Following Johnson were Ward, Matt Sheppard, Vic Coffey and Chad Brachmann. Paine, Gary Tomkins, Cozze, Justin Haers and Tom Sears finished out the top ten. Hea5t winners for the 29 cars were Jeff Strunk, Tim Fuller and Bret Hearn. Stewart Friesen won the consolation. Billy Decker set fast time and a new one-lap track record of 19.016 seconds.

Myers started 10th as Allan Brannon took the lead from the outside pole with Andy Anderson and Nathan Durboraw right behind. Myers worked his way into the top five by the sixth lap as he battled it out with Booper Bare. While Anderson and Durboraw fought hard for the runner-up spot, Brannon set the pace out in front. Anderson closed in on Brannon, but went high coming off the fourth turn on the 17th lap allowing Brannon to open up a 10-car length lead. On lap 19, Bare rolled to a stop to bring out the caution and on the restart, Anderson had mechanical problems to bring out another caution putting Durboraw and Myers on Brannon's bumper for the restart. Myers used the low groove to get by Durboraw on lap 23 and then went after Brannon. Just when it looked like Brannon would get the win, Myers came off the fourth turn low to pass Brannon at the finish line for the win. Durboraw settled for third with Gary Stuhler and Bo Feathers rounding out the top five. Frankie Plessinger came from 18th for sixth with D.J. Troutman, Devin Friese, Brian Booze and Sean Cosgrove finishing out the top ten. Heat winners for the 30 cars were Cosgrove, Stuhler and Ronnie Dehaven. Booze won the consolation.
